Entry number 26 for the 2022 365 Black & White Challenge is a photograph from the 2022 Australian Open.
Back to the Open (whilst it’s still going) for today’s photograph.
Not only did I enjoy watching the tennis on display, which was the primary aim of going, but I enjoyed planning photographs before taking them. This is not something I normally do. My specialty has always been to grab moments as they happen in front of me at the speed of one thousand startled gazelles, however, in this case, I knew the photograph I wanted to get, positioned myself accordingly and waited.
It’s moments like this that highlight that although the creative part of photography is incredibly important, you should never ignore the technical side. Knowing the settings I needed and having them preset to force the background into burry goodness meant I only had to wait, grab focus quickly, and shoot.
